Job Description

Reporting to the Group Financial Controller, this role will lead and manage the accounting and commercial finance data, controls and reporting for the leased and owned vehicle assets for the GPL and GPFS businesses. This includes the ownership of the Vehicle Fixed Asset Register and Lease Register.

This role is responsible to working with the operational, treasury and controls teams within the Group to financially optimize the vehicle portfolio this includes:

· Working with funding partners to ensure a fit for purpose funding panel and being the expert on the financial structuring of funder agreements.

· Managing the control environment in relation to vehicle lifecycle reporting and data

· Ensuring the integrity of the ledger, sub ledgers and associated financial reports, including funder capacity reporting.

· Understanding and educating the business and finance teams on the impact of buy/lease/dispose decisions on financial statements including cash flow.

· Working with the commercial teams on tenders and bids when assessing new business opportunities.

· Input of vehicle data and insight into the GPL and GPFS financial forecasts.

· Delivering the residual values reporting and risk assessment

Key Responsibilities:

· Manage and develop a team of 2 direct reports and matrix management across Controlling, Treasury, Vehicle and Transactional finance teams.

· Own the day-to-day relationships with funders, providing management information and leading audits.

· Input of FAR and Lease data into the statutory accounts for GPL and GPFS – Liaising with External auditors dealing on audit matters for the Group on these areas

· Ownership of the FAR and Lease register and associated balance sheet postings and reconciliations, including impairment, additions and disposals.

· Oversee, maintain, and develop the compliance and controls environment for vehicles throughout their lifecycle.

· Own the fixed asset and lease accounting and controls working closely with the Controlling team.

· Deliver timely and accurate financial reporting to internal and external stakeholders, including Board Reporting.

· Lead any FRS developments that impact fixed assets or leases, ensuring impact analysis is completed and required changes implemented in timely and controlled manner.

· Input lease and capex cash flows into the treasury team

· Providing analysis and input into the financial forecast and budgets, including balance sheet and cash flow forecasts

· Own the residual value revaluation process, in conjunction with operations and ensure this is accurately reflected in the financial statements.

· Drive a continuous improvement ethos within the team and function. Working closely with transactional manager and IT
